GOSHEN – Orange County Executive Edward A. Diana is pleased to announce that Richard Mayfield has been appointed to fill the top spot at the Orange County Office of Community Development, a position he has held as Acting Director since November 2011. Mayfield’s appointment was unanimously approved by the Orange County Legislature.
Prior to being named Director of Community of Development, Mayfield served as the County’s Director of Operations. He joined the County Executive’s staff in 2007 as press secretary and assistant to the County Executive.

A life-long Orange County resident, Mayfield and his wife Deborah reside in the Town of Newburgh. Richard served as District Director for Congressman Ben Gilman for 12 years and Director of the Office of Inter-Governmental Relations with the New York State Assembly.
